POSITION TITLE: Coordinator II: Payroll
REPORTS TO: Executive Director - Finance CATEGORY: Administration/12 Months/IMRF
FLSA: Exempt SALARY: Regionally Competitive
Primary Purpose: Coordinate and assure successful processing of employee payroll. Prepare required payroll-related reports.
Essential Functions
· Prepare payrolls for all District personnel
· Maintain payroll ledgers
· Compute all voluntary and involuntary deductions
· Compute all salary adjustments
· Filing of all quarterly and annual federal and state payroll taxes
· Filing of all annual Teachers Retirement System and Illinois Municipal Retirement System Reports
· Ad Hoc analyses
· Responsible for payroll training and professional development
· Other duties and responsibilities as assigned or directed by the Executive Director - Finance
· Willing to schedule vacations around job requirements
Qualifications/Requirements:
To be considered for this position, the candidate must possess the following required education, certification, skills, experience and/or qualifications:
· Post high school education
· Prior experience as a payroll coordinator, clerk or manager
The successful candidate for this position should also possess the following desired skills, experience and/or qualifications:
· Bachelor's degree in accounting, business or related field
· Experience processing payroll through Infinite Visions
· Experience as a payroll coordinator in a school district.
· Strong technical skills relative to the management of payroll systems
· Computer skills, including: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, personnel and payroll systems
· Understanding of federal and state payroll and tax laws and regulations
· Experience with pension payroll accounting (TRS and IMRF)
· Understanding of business office procedures
· Good communication skills
· Aptitude for detailed work
· Strong analytical skills
· Ability to work independently
· Evidence of successful work experience and a strong attendance
· Ability to work well under pressure and meet deadlines
· Ability to assist in training and motivating staff in an effective manner
